The Army recently deployed double humped camels for logistical support to the troops in eastern Ladakh. Double Humped Camels or Bactrian camels, have two humps on their backs where they store fat. Scientific Name: Camelus bactrianus They are native to the harsh and arid regions of Central Asia. They occupy habitats in Central Asia from Afghanistan to China, primarily up into the Mongolian steppes and the Gobi desertÂ
